Transaction fa3db6f7a069529846041b8408cf508b030d10871af980f2b0ab30a5ec34f635

2 Input
2 Outputs
  • fa3db6f7a069529846041b8408cf508b030d10871af980f2b0ab30a5ec34f635:0
  • value  648909
    address  19T7L2pDz43ZAUcJ2iSxhaMZUnW8n5ghxw
  • fa3db6f7a069529846041b8408cf508b030d10871af980f2b0ab30a5ec34f635:1
  • value  15350293
    address  16ZStVrKu2i7w9fGCsjYdE9bkx343CSJF2